TM 9-2540-207-14&P 5-44 5.7.1 Burner Assembly (Applies to all Design Iterations) Figure 5.7-2 Combustor Assembly 5.7.1.1 Removal 1. Remove Top Shell (ref. 5.4.2). 2. Remove Bottom Shell (ref. 5.4.3). 3. Remove Vent Fan Assembly (ref. 5.6.1). 4. Disconnect the Fuel Line connected to the Burner Housing by releasing the hose clamp and pulling the Fuel Line straight off the fitting on the Burner. DO NOT REMOVE FUEL LINE FROM THE TOP HOUSING. 5. Remove Ignitor Wire from Ignitor Post. 6. Using a 7/16" open ended wrench, disconnect the Burner Sensor from the Burner Housing by undoing the nut from the fitting. Note: The brass Burner Sensor and Fuel fittings are installed into the Burner Housing with Loctite 620 and should NOT be removed. Note: If the metal primary air duct is being used, no clamps will be present. 7. Remove the nylon clamp holding the Primary Air Duct to the Top Housing by disengaging the locking jaws. 8. Ensure that the Primary Air Duct is not kinked. Align as necessary.
